NASA Voyager 1 & 2: 1977 onwards (VGR77-1 to VGR-3, including Pioneer 10 & 11) : an insight into the history, technology, mission planning and operation of NASA's deep space probe sent to study the outer planets and beyond

Voyager 1 has recently crossed the boundary of our solar system and passed into interstellar space, and Voyager 2 is likely to follow suit, on a different path, between 2016 and 2017. The two Voyager probes will continue to transmit details of discoveries beyond our solar system until at least 2020
